Yeshiva University’s Zysman Hall looks like a mosque. It’s a relic of the “Moorish” trend among Western Jews, which embraced Judaism’s “Oriental” roots and viewed Islam as a sister religion. Read in my @thedispatch piece: "A Muslim Walks into a Yeshiva" thedispatch.com/newsletter/dis…
